Verse 9

Ephraim shall be desolate in the day of rebuke: among the tribes of Israel have I made known that which shall surely be.

  • biblecontext

    { "verseID": "Hosea.5.9", "source": "אֶפְרַ֙יִם֙ לְשַׁמָּ֣ה תִֽהְיֶ֔ה בְּי֖וֹם תּֽוֹכֵחָ֑ה בְּשִׁבְטֵי֙ יִשְׂרָאֵ֔ל הוֹדַ֖עְתִּי נֶאֱמָנָֽה׃", "text": "*ʾEp̄rayim* for-*šammâ* *ṯihyê* in-day of-*tôḵēḥâ*; among-*šiḇṭê* *Yiśrāʾēl* *hôḏaʿtî* *neʾĕmānâ*.", "grammar": { "*ʾEp̄rayim*": "proper noun - Ephraim", "*šammâ*": "noun, feminine singular - desolation/waste", "*ṯihyê*": "imperfect, 3rd person feminine singular - she will be/become", "*tôḵēḥâ*": "noun, feminine singular - rebuke/reproof", "*šiḇṭê*": "noun, masculine plural construct - tribes of", "*Yiśrāʾēl*": "proper noun - Israel", "*hôḏaʿtî*": "perfect, hiphil, 1st person singular - I have made known", "*neʾĕmānâ*": "participle, niphal, feminine singular - that which is faithful/sure" }, "variants": { "*šammâ*": "desolation/waste/horror/astonishment", "*ṯihyê*": "she will be/she will become", "*tôḵēḥâ*": "rebuke/reproof/correction/punishment", "*šiḇṭê*": "tribes of/rods of", "*hôḏaʿtî*": "I have made known/I have declared/I have shown", "*neʾĕmānâ*": "faithful/sure/reliable/trustworthy" } }

  • Coverdale Bible (1535)

    In the tyme of ye plage shal Ephraim be layed waist, therfore dyd I faithfully warne the trybes of Israel.

  • Geneva Bible (1560)

    Ephraim shall be desolate in the day of rebuke: among the tribes of Israel haue I caused to knowe the trueth.

  • Bishops' Bible (1568)

    In the tyme of the plague shall Ephraim be layde waste: in the tribes of Israel haue I shewed the trueth.

  • Authorized King James Version (1611)

    Ephraim shall be desolate in the day of rebuke: among the tribes of Israel have I made known that which shall surely be.

  • Webster's Bible (1833)

    Ephraim will become a desolation in the day of rebuke. Among the tribes of Israel, I have made known that which will surely be.

  • Young's Literal Translation (1862/1898)

    Ephraim is for a desolation in a day of reproof, Among the tribes of Israel I have made known a sure thing.

  • American Standard Version (1901)

    Ephraim shall become a desolation in the day of rebuke: among the tribes of Israel have I made known that which shall surely be.

  • Bible in Basic English (1941)

    Ephraim will become a waste in the day of punishment; I have given knowledge among the tribes of Israel of what is certain.

  • World English Bible (2000)

    Ephraim will become a desolation in the day of rebuke. Among the tribes of Israel, I have made known that which will surely be.

  • NET Bible® (New English Translation)

    Ephraim will be ruined in the day of judgment! What I am declaring to the tribes of Israel will certainly take place!
